Discover the Crucial Tips for Effective Airbnb Cleaning That Will Impress Your Visitors



When it comes to Airbnb cleaning, thrilling your visitors begins with a solid plan. Allow's explore exactly how you can boost your space and guarantee guests leave with an enduring impression.


Establish a Comprehensive Cleansing Checklist



Creating a complete cleansing list can make your Airbnb turn over process smoother and more reliable. Begin by noting all locations in your room, consisting of bed rooms, washrooms, cooking area, and living locations. Damage down each area right into particular jobs. For instance, in the cooking area, consist of cleaning down countertops, cleansing devices, and cleaning meals.


Don't forget the information-- look for dirt on surfaces, tidy mirrors, and vacuum cleaner carpetings. Consist of washing jobs like transforming bed linens and towels, as fresh linens can leave a lasting perception.


By following this checklist, you'll simplify your cleansing process, lower tension, and ensure your visitors arrive to a spick-and-span environment. Plus, a clean home improves visitor fulfillment and urges positive reviews, which is important for your Airbnb success.


Focus On High-Traffic Areas



Since visitors are likely to spend more time in certain locations of your Airbnb, focusing on high-traffic zones throughout your cleaning routine is vital. Emphasis on areas like the living space, washroom, and kitchen, where visitors gather and use frequently. Beginning by decluttering these areas, as a neat area immediately really feels more welcoming.


Next, offer special focus to surface areas that build up dust and crud, such as tables, kitchen counters, and chairs. Do not neglect to tidy floors thoroughly; a fast vacuum or sweep can make a substantial difference.


In the restroom, verify that sinks, commodes, and shower locations are pristine, as these are necessary for guest convenience (Commercial Cleaning). Make use of a dust roller for furniture and paddings to maintain them fresh. By focusing on these high-traffic locations, you'll produce a welcoming ambience that leaves an enduring impact on your visitors, improving their overall remain


Make Use Of the Right Cleaning Products



After taking on the high-traffic areas, it's time to review the cleansing items you use. Choosing the best cleansing products can make all the distinction in achieving a spick-and-span room that wows your guests. Start by selecting all-purpose cleansers that work on various surfaces, saving you effort and time. Seek eco-friendly alternatives to attract ecologically mindful visitors; they'll value your commitment to sustainability.


Don't forget disinfectants-- specifically in kitchen areas and restrooms. Make sure they're EPA-approved for maximum performance versus bacteria. Microfiber fabrics are important for wiping and cleaning down surfaces considering that they record dust without damaging.


For floorings, find a cleaner ideal for your floor covering type, whether it's hardwood, laminate, or tile. Take into consideration adding an enjoyable aroma with air fresheners or crucial oils, as a fresh-smelling space improves the overall experience. Your option of items can absolutely elevate your Airbnb's tidiness and ambiance.


Take Note Of Information



Although it might be appealing to concentrate only on the big tasks, focusing on information can absolutely set your Airbnb apart. Visitors frequently notice the little points that may seem irrelevant yet can make a huge influence on their experience. Examine for dirt on racks, fingerprints on windows, and stains on upholstery. Make sure light switches and remotes are tidy and working properly.

Don't overlook the cooking area; verify utensils are pristine and neatly organized. In the shower room, take note of toiletries-- are they equipped and neatly provided?




Small touches, like fluffing pillows and folding towels nicely, reveal that you respect their convenience.


Also the aroma of your room matters; take into consideration utilizing a refined air freshener or opening up windows to allow in fresh air. By focusing on these information, you'll produce a welcoming space that leaves an enduring impression and urges favorable reviews.


Produce a Welcoming Environment



To produce an inviting environment, begin with fresh linens and towels that make your visitors feel pampered. Adding thoughtful welcome services, like treats or regional handouts, reveals you respect their experience. Don't forget to boost the area with inviting design and lighting that sets a relaxing tone.




Fresh Linens and Towels



Creating a welcoming ambience begins with fresh linens and towels that make your guests feel right at home. When you supply crisp, cosy towels and tidy sheets, you promptly boost their experience.


Your visitors will value the effort you place into these basics, making them a lot more most likely to leave positive reviews and return for future keeps. Fresh linens and towels absolutely set the phase for an unforgettable visit!


Thoughtful Welcome Features



Offering thoughtful welcome amenities can make all the distinction in how your guests regard their remain. A small basket with snacks, mineral water, or local deals with creates a cozy, inviting environment. Take into consideration leaving an individualized note, inviting them and sharing suggestions concerning the area. Fresh blossoms or a potted plant can also brighten their mood and boost the room. If your property has a kitchen area, equipping it with important products like sugar, coffee, and tea programs you respect their convenience. Do not forget the importance of toiletries; premium soaps and shampoos can boost their experience. By placing in this extra effort, you'll make your guests feel valued, ensuring they leave with fond memories of their remain.


Inviting Decoration and Lights



When visitors stroll into an area that feels warm and welcoming, they're most likely to unwind and enjoy their stay. To achieve this, concentrate on your style and lights. Usage soft, neutral colors for walls and home furnishings to create a calming ambience. Individual touches, like neighborhood art work or plants, can add character without overwhelming the senses.


Consider including lamps with dimmers to change the state of mind as needed. Keep in mind, a well-decorated room with thoughtful illumination not just enhances convenience however additionally makes your guests really feel at home, urging them to leave radiant testimonials.


Maintain a Constant Cleansing Schedule



Keeping a consistent cleansing timetable is crucial for keeping your Airbnb in top form and guaranteeing visitor contentment. By establishing a routine cleansing routine, you produce a dependable atmosphere for your visitors, which helps establish depend on and encourages positive evaluations. Beginning by determining a cleaning regularity that matches your home and visitor turnover.


After each guest's remain, designate time for thorough cleaning, including dusting, vacuuming, and sterilizing high-touch locations. Do not neglect to check navigate to this website towels and linens, ensuring they're fresh and clean for the following arrival.


Along with post-checkout cleansing, consider scheduling regular upkeep jobs, such as deep cleansing rugs or home windows. This will certainly protect against dust build-up and maintain your home looking excellent.


Lastly, stay with your routine as carefully as possible. Consistency not only enhances your guests' experience yet also mirrors your dedication to top quality friendliness.


Gather Comments and Adjust Accordingly



After establishing a regular cleaning routine, the next step is to collect responses from your visitors. This comments is indispensable in understanding just how well you're fulfilling their assumptions. Motivate guests to leave testimonials, and do not think twice to ask for their opinions straight. Take notice of remarks regarding cleanliness, amenities, and total experience.


As soon as you've collected this responses, evaluate it to recognize patterns or persisting issues. If visitors mention details areas needing improvement, like cleaning or restocking products, make those modifications promptly. You may additionally think about performing a brief study after their remain to collect more thorough insights.


Often Asked Inquiries



How Usually Should I Deep Clean My Airbnb Building?



You must deep cleanse your Airbnb home a minimum of once a month. Nonetheless, if you have high turn over or animals, take into consideration doing it more often. Regular deep cleaning keeps your room fresh and inviting for guests.


What Are Eco-Friendly Cleaning Product Options?



When you're choosing environment-friendly cleaning products, think about choices like vinegar, baking soft drink, and castile soap. They're effective, secure for your guests, and much better for the setting. You'll be amazed at their cleansing power!


Exactly How Can I Take Care Of Cleaning After a Pet Dog Keep?



After a pet stay, vacuum thoroughly to get rid of hair, usage enzyme cleansers for spots, and clean all linens. Do not fail to remember to air out the area and look for any kind of remaining smells to assure freshness.


Should I Employ Specialist Cleaners or Do It Myself?



You need to consider your time and budget plan. Working with specialists could be best if you're hectic or desire a complete tidy. If you take pleasure in cleaning up and have the time, doing it yourself can save cash.


How Can I Minimize Cleansing Time In Between Guests?



To minimize cleansing time between visitors, develop a checklist, declutter on a regular basis, utilize multi-purpose cleaners, and maintain necessary materials stocked. Focus on high-traffic locations and take into consideration other a cleansing schedule to streamline your procedure efficiently.
